How is the weather in Glacier?
Glacier has rainy winters near 32–42°F (0–6°C) and mild, drier summers with afternoons around 70–78°F (21–26°C). Spring and fall can bring variable temperatures and a mix of sunshine and showers.
When is the best time to visit Glacier?
Late spring through early fall is often recommended for a mix of clear days and lush scenery. Winter draws visitors to enjoy snow activities on the local slopes and forests.

What are some local tips for visiting Glacier?
Pack layers, including a waterproof jacket—rain arrives often, even in summer. Respect trail etiquette, support locally owned eateries, and check road conditions in winter before heading to higher elevations.
